Silver Bay is home to the Northwoods Ski Trail, which is located just outside of city limits, off of Penn avenue. It is a beautiful wooded, single track trail that follows the Beaver River. It then moves away from the river over rolling hills and eventually connects to the trails at Tettegouche State Park. Tettegouche State Park offers just over 15 miles of groomed trails, four of which are for skate skiing. The Silver Bay area has a wide range of moderate to difficult trails that include flat and smooth straightaways to long and fast downhills. No matter if you’re a first time skier or an expert who’s logged too many kilometers to count, we have trails for all experience types coupled with pristine beauty that all can enjoy.
When the cross-country trails are not at their best, snowshoeing is a perfect alternative. Tettegouche, Split Rock and Crosby Manitou in Finland are all beautiful areas to explore on snowshoes.
